Efficient staff scheduling in hospitals is paramount to both the quality of patient care and the well-being of healthcare professionals. Poorly managed schedules can lead to staff burnout, compromised patient care, and increased operational costs. This article will explore comprehensive strategies to optimize staff scheduling, thereby enhancing patient care and reducing burnout among healthcare workers.
Optimal staff scheduling ensures that there are enough healthcare professionals to cater to the needs of patients at all times. This reduces waiting time, improves patient satisfaction, and enhances the overall quality of care. Furthermore, well-rested staff are more likely to make fewer errors and deliver better patient outcomes.
Healthcare professionals often work long hours in high-stress environments, leading to burnout. An optimized schedule that considers the needs and preferences of staff can significantly reduce burnout. This includes creating a balance between work and personal life, ensuring adequate rest periods, and avoiding consecutive shifts.
Key strategies for optimizing staff scheduling include using advanced scheduling software that can handle complex staffing needs, incorporating staff input into scheduling decisions, and regularly reviewing and adjusting schedules based on changing needs. Additionally, cross-training staff to perform multiple roles can provide more flexibility in scheduling.
Optimizing staff scheduling in hospitals is a critical aspect of healthcare management that can significantly improve patient care and reduce staff burnout. By leveraging technology, considering staff input, and promoting flexibility, healthcare organizations can create effective schedules that meet the needs of both patients and healthcare professionals. As the healthcare landscape continues to evolve, it is crucial for hospitals to adopt a comprehensive approach to staff scheduling to stay ahead of the curve.
